ACWX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2024 in Review

440 of the 6,942 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ares MSCI ACWI ex US ETF (ACWX) for Q1 2024, worth a combined $3.41B — down 1.2% from $3.45B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 46 funds closed out of ACWX and 35 opened new positions — a net loss of 11 holders — while 164 trimmed existing stakes and 109 added.

The largest buyer was Flow Traders U.S., adding an estimated $45.4M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$219M.
